Quick Answer: The Three Exercise Categories That Actually Work for Chronic Lumbar Pain
When evaluating what kind of exercises help relieve chronic lower back pain at home, the answer lies in understanding three fundamental categories: motor control, mobility, and endurance. These aren’t just buzzwords they represent distinct physiological mechanisms that address the root causes of persistent lumbar discomfort.
Dr. Stuart McGill’s decades of spine research established that healthy spines require stiffness during movement, not excessive flexibility or brute strength. Motor control exercises teach your nervous system to activate the right muscles at the right time, creating protective stiffness around your spine. Mobility work addresses joint restrictions that force your lower back to compensate during daily activities. Endurance training builds the fatigue resistance that keeps your spinal stabilizers working throughout long days.
| Exercise Category | Primary Mechanism | Example Movements | Key Benefit |
|---|---|---|---|
| Motor Control | Neuromuscular patterning and timing | Bird dog, dead bug, McGill curl-up | Teaches spine protection during movement |
| Mobility | Joint capsule and muscle extensibility | 90/90 stretch, couch stretch, cat-cow | Reduces compensatory lumbar motion |
| Endurance | Fatigue resistance in stabilizers | Side plank progressions, pallof press | Sustains spinal support throughout day |
The research is clear: combining these three categories produces superior outcomes compared to any single approach. A comprehensive program addresses both the hardware (joints and muscles) and software (nervous system control) of your spine.

Why Traditional Core Exercises Often Worsen Chronic Back Pain [Biomechanics Analysis]
Here’s an uncomfortable truth: the exercises most people do for their back are often the ones making it worse. Sit-ups, crunches, and generic planks frequently increase pain rather than reduce it. Understanding why requires examining spinal biomechanics.
Your spine has a finite number of bending cycles before tissue damage accumulates. Dr. McGill’s research demonstrated that repeated spinal flexion the bending forward motion in sit-ups creates disc herniations in laboratory settings when combined with compression. Each sit-up places approximately 3300N of compressive force on the lumbar spine. For someone already dealing with disc irritation or flexion intolerance, this is like poking a bruise and expecting it to heal.
Flexion intolerance means your back pain worsens with forward bending movements. This describes the majority of chronic lower back cases, particularly those involving disc issues. Yet well-meaning individuals continue performing exercises that put their spine through repeated flexion cycles, wondering why their pain persists despite “strengthening their core.”
- Sit-ups and crunches: Create high compressive forces through repeated spinal flexion, aggravating disc issues and potentially accelerating degeneration in sensitive spines.
- Leg raises: Generate substantial shear forces on the lumbar spine when core control is insufficient, often causing compensatory arching.
- Superman extensions: Place extreme compressive loads on posterior spinal elements, particularly problematic for those with extension intolerance or stenosis.
- Rotational crunches: Combine flexion with rotation the exact mechanism proven to herniate discs in laboratory studies.
- Holding plank forever: When endurance is lacking, the lumbar spine sags into extension, creating the very problem the exercise attempts to solve.
The problem isn’t “core exercises” themselves it’s selecting movements that challenge your trunk musculature without overstressing your spinal structures. This distinction separates ineffective or harmful routines from therapeutic protocols.

McGill’s Big Three: The Gold Standard for Spinal Stabilization at Home
After studying thousands of backs, Dr. Stuart McGill identified three exercises that consistently improved spinal health without causing harm. These movements collectively called “The Big Three” address flexion, lateral, and extension stability while minimizing spinal load. They form the foundation of evidence-based low back rehabilitation.
The philosophy is simple: these are anti-movement exercises. Rather than moving your spine through ranges, you resist movement while your extremities move. This challenges your core stabilizers while keeping your spine in a neutral, protected position.
- McGill Curl-Up: Lie on your back with one leg bent, one leg straight. Place your hands under your lower back to monitor position. Slowly lift your head and shoulders while pressing your low back into your hands no movement in the spine itself. Hold for 8-10 seconds, breathing normally throughout. The straight leg protects the spine while the bent leg positions your pelvis optimally. Progress by pre-bracing your core before lifting.
- Side Plank: Lie on your side with knees bent at 90 degrees, elbow directly under your shoulder. Lift your hips off the floor, creating a straight line from knees to head. Hold for 10-15 seconds initially, focusing on the bottom lateral muscles working to hold position. Keep breathing holding your breath increases internal pressure unnecessarily. Progress by straightening your legs to increase the lever arm.
- Bird Dog: Start on hands and knees in a tabletop position. Simultaneously extend your opposite arm and leg, moving slowly with control. The challenge isn’t reaching high it’s keeping your spine completely still while your limbs move. Imagine a glass of water balanced on your lower back that shouldn’t spill. Hold each side for 8-10 seconds, returning to neutral before switching sides.
The key differentiator between these and traditional core work is bracing rather than flexing. You’re creating a stiff cylinder around your spine that resists bending in any direction. This is exactly what your core should do during daily activities prevent unwanted motion, not create it.

Hip Mobility Drills That Reduce Lumbar Compensation Patterns [Movement Study]
Your lower back often becomes a victim of stiffness elsewhere. Tight hips force your lumbar spine to compensate during walking, sitting, and bending. When your hip flexors are shortened from prolonged sitting, your pelvis tilts forward, increasing compressive forces on your lower back with every step. Restricted hip rotation forces your spine to twist during activities that should occur through your hip joints.
Restoring hip mobility removes the compensatory burden from your lower back. These aren’t passive stretches they’re active mobility drills that improve joint function while reinforcing proper movement patterns.
- 90/90 Hip Stretch: Sit on the floor with one leg in front at 90 degrees, the other to the side at 90 degrees. Rotate between internal and external rotation positions, holding each for 2-3 seconds. Perform 10-15 rotations per side, daily.
- Couch Stretch: Kneel facing away from a wall with your back shin pressed against it. Squeeze your glute while driving your hips forward slightly. Hold for 1-2 minutes per side, ideally daily or after prolonged sitting.
- Supine Hip Rotation: Lie on your back with knees bent at 90 degrees. Slowly lower both knees to one side while keeping your shoulders flat. Hold the end range for 2-3 seconds before rotating to the opposite side. Perform 15-20 repetitions, daily.
- Prone Hip Internal Rotation: Lie face down with one knee bent at 90 degrees. Let your foot fall outward while keeping your hip pressed into the floor. Hold the stretch position for 30 seconds, repeat 3 times per side.
- Standing Hip Flexor Stretch: In a lunge position with back knee straight, squeeze your back glute and shift weight forward slightly. Hold for 30-60 seconds per side, particularly useful after long periods of sitting.
- Piriformis Figure-4: Lie on your back with one ankle crossed over the opposite knee. Pull the uncrossed leg toward your chest until you feel a stretch in your outer hip. Hold for 30-60 seconds, repeating 2-3 times per side.

Dead Bug Progressions: Building Anti-Extension Core Control Without Spinal Flexion
The dead bug series represents the evolution of core training for back pain. Unlike traditional exercises that flex or extend the spine, dead bugs challenge you to maintain a neutral spine position while your limbs move independently. This mirrors real-world demands your arms and legs move constantly while your spine remains stable.
The starting position teaches posterior pelvic tilt and rib positioning that protects your lower back. Lie on your back with arms extended toward the ceiling and knees bent at 90 degrees over your hips. Press your lower back flat into the floor you should feel your deep core muscles engage.
- Level 1 Single Limb Movement: From the starting position, slowly lower one arm overhead while maintaining flat low back contact. Return to start, then lower the opposite leg toward the floor without your back arching. Alternate sides for 10-12 repetitions each limb. This establishes the fundamental coordination pattern.
- Level 2 Oppositional Movement: Simultaneously lower your right arm and left leg toward the floor. Move slowly one full breath per repetition. The challenge increases significantly as your core must resist rotation and extension simultaneously. Perform 8-10 repetitions per side.
- Level 3 Straight Leg Variation: Extend both legs straight up toward the ceiling. Lower one leg toward the floor while maintaining flat back position. The longer lever dramatically increases anti-extension demand. Perform 8-10 repetitions per leg.
- Level 4 Extended Holds: Lower both arms overhead and both legs toward the floor simultaneously, stopping before your back arches. Hold this position for 5-10 seconds while breathing normally. This advanced variation builds exceptional endurance in deep stabilizers.
Breathing is crucial throughout all progression levels. Holding your breath increases intra-abdominal pressure and allows you to “cheat” by using pressure rather than muscular control. Exhale during the effort phase, inhale during the return.

Daily Movement Patterns: Integrating Pain-Free Mechanics into Routine Activities
Exercise sessions matter, but you move for the other 15+ hours of your waking day. How you perform daily activities often impacts your back more than your workout routine. Integrating proper mechanics into routine movements reduces cumulative spinal stress significantly.
The hip hinge represents the foundational movement pattern for back health. Rather than bending forward from your spine which creates flexion and disc pressure the hip hinge involves pushing your hips backward while maintaining a neutral spine. This pattern protects your back during everything from picking up laundry to loading the dishwasher.
- Getting out of bed: Roll onto your side, drop your legs off the bed, and push up with your arms rather than doing an abdominal sit-up motion to rise.
- Brushing teeth: Hinge at your hips with slight knee bend rather than slumping forward with a flexed spine over the sink.
- Sitting to standing: Scoot to the edge of your chair, feet flat, and push through your heels while maintaining an upright torso rather than pitching forward.
- Standing from floor: Use the half-kneel position step one foot forward, then push up rather than bending and rounding forward to stand.
- Lifting objects: Hip hinge with the object close to your body, engage your glutes to return upright rather than using your back muscles to pull.
- Prolonged sitting: Set a 30-minute timer. Stand, perform 10 hip circles or a brief walk, then return. Motion is medicine for spinal discs.
- Reaching overhead: Step toward the object and reach with your arm rather than extending through your lower back to close the distance.
These micro-adjustments accumulate throughout the day. If you bend your spine 100 times daily with poor mechanics, even the best exercise program can’t overcome that repetitive stress. Conversely, consistent attention to movement quality multiplies the benefits of your therapeutic exercises.

When Home Exercise Requires Professional Guidance: Red Flags and Progression Indicators
Home exercises empower you to manage your back pain, but certain signs indicate the need for professional evaluation. Recognizing these red flags prevents delays in appropriate treatment and ensures your home routine supports rather than hinders recovery.
Neurological symptoms warrant immediate attention. Numbness or tingling in your legs, weakness in your foot (such as difficulty walking on your heels or toes), or changes in bowel or bladder function suggest nerve involvement that requires assessment. Similarly, pain that worsens despite consistent exercise, or spreads down your leg below the knee, indicates progression beyond simple mechanical back pain.
| Self-Manageable Symptoms | Professional Consultation Recommended |
|---|---|
| Localized low back ache after activity | Pain radiating below the knee |
| Morning stiffness improving with movement | Numbness or tingling in legs/feet |
| Muscle fatigue during exercise | Weakness in leg or foot muscles |
| Soreness resolving within 24 hours | Pain worsening over 2+ weeks |
| Consistent movement patterns | Loss of coordination or balance |
| Gradual improvement over weeks | Changes in bowel/bladder function |
Progress plateaus represent another indicator. If your symptoms improve initially but then stagnate for 3-4 weeks despite consistent effort, professional intervention may identify barriers your home program isn’t addressing. Joint restrictions, muscle adhesions, or underlying biomechanical issues often require hands-on treatment before exercises become fully effective.

Key Takeaways: Building Your Evidence-Based Home Exercise Protocol
Constructing an effective home exercise program for chronic lower back pain requires strategic selection and progression. The evidence points toward specific principles that maximize outcomes while minimizing risk of aggravation.
- Motor control priority: Begin with exercises that retrain movement patterns (McGill’s Big Three, dead bugs) before adding strength or endurance challenges the nervous system learns before it performs.
- Frequency over intensity: Daily practice of 10-15 minutes produces better outcomes than longer, less frequent sessions consistency builds neuromuscular pathways.
- Neutral spine emphasis: Select exercises that challenge your core without moving your spine through flexion, extension, or rotation anti-movement training for anti-pain results.
- Hip mobility integration: Address hip restrictions that force lumbar compensation your back often hurts because your hips don’t move.
- Progressive overload principles: Increase duration or complexity gradually start with 8-10 second holds and progress to 15-20 seconds before advancing to harder variations.
- Functional pattern practice: Apply proper mechanics to daily activities exercise carries over when you integrate movement quality into real life.
The most successful protocols combine these elements into a sustainable routine. One that challenges your system enough to create adaptation but not so much that it provokes symptoms. This balance requires attention to your body’s responses and willingness to modify when needed.

Frequently Asked Questions About Home Exercises for Chronic Lower Back Pain
How often should I perform these exercises for chronic lower back pain?
Daily practice is optimal. Research demonstrates that motor control exercises require frequent repetition to establish new movement patterns. Short sessions of 15-20 minutes daily outperform longer sessions done 2-3 times weekly. Think of it like learning any skill consistency builds neural pathways more effectively than intensity.
Should I continue exercising if I feel pain during the movements?
No, modify or stop. Therapeutic exercises should produce muscle fatigue or mild effort, not pain. Sharp pain, pain that intensifies, or symptoms that radiate indicate the movement isn’t appropriate for your current condition. Reduce the range of motion, decrease hold times, or regress to an easier variation. Persistent pain during exercise warrants professional assessment.
How long before I notice improvement in my back pain?
4-6 weeks for meaningful change. Neuromuscular adaptation requires consistent practice over time. Some individuals notice improved movement awareness within 2-3 weeks, but measurable pain reduction typically emerges between weeks 4-6 of consistent practice. Significant functional improvement often requires 8-12 weeks of dedicated effort.
Are these exercises safe for everyone with chronic lower back pain?
Generally safe, but individual variation exists. The exercises presented minimize spinal load and avoid positions that commonly aggravate back pain. However, specific conditions like severe stenosis, spondylolisthesis, or acute disc hernications may require modified approaches. Professional guidance ensures your program matches your specific diagnosis and presentation.
Can I do these exercises if I currently have acute back pain?
Modify intensity significantly. During acute episodes, gentle mobility and static positions like lying with knees supported may be more appropriate than active exercises. As acute symptoms subside, reintroduce exercises at reduced intensity. Attempting full programs during acute phases may prolong recovery.
Do I need special equipment for these home exercises?
No specialized equipment required. These exercises use bodyweight and household surfaces. A yoga mat provides comfort, and a wall or chair offers support for balance during progression. This simplicity ensures you can perform your routine anywhere without barriers to consistency.
